Archaeology Notes

HY33SE 90 3752 3136

This farmstead comprises the remains of a building and three enclosures recorded on oblique aerial photographs (RCAHMSAP 2009). Two roofed buildings and three enclosures are shown on the 1st edition of the OS 6-inch map (Orkney 1882, lxxxiv).

Information from RCAHMS (LMcC) 4 November 2010

Field Visit (13 May 2015)

This farmstead comprises two buildings, - a range set parallel to but detached from the NW side of a roughly square yard or enclosure and a second, much smaller, structure adjoining the yard at the NW end of its SW side. The range, which is constructed of lime-mortared stone and orientated across the slope, measures 18m from NE to SW by 4.5m transversely over walls averaging 0.7m in thickness and surviving up to 2.2m in height. It contains two large compartments, each fitted with a fireplace and a press-cupboard, but there were also originally outshots, of which little is now visible, at both the NE and SW ends of the range, The buildings are depicted roofed on both the 1st and 2nd editions of the 25-inch map (Orkney, Sheet LXXXIV.16, 1882; 1902); the farmstead is also shown on the 3rd edition of the OS 1-inch to a mile map of Scotland (1912, Sheet 119, Kirkwall).

Visited by RCAHMS (GFG) 13 May 2015

Note (7 November 2016)

A building with an attached enclosure is annotated as 'Old School House' on a location plan drawn in 1936.

Information from HES Survey and Recording (AK) 7 November 2016
